UbuntuやDebian使うときにC/C++の開発をするパッケージ揃えるのめんどくさいー! だとか、makeでビルドしたいだけなのに色々考えてインストールするのめんどくさいー!

ってないですか?

僕はたくさんありますし、説明ももうめんどくさいです。

 

そんなあなたにコレ! build-essential !!

使い方は簡単です。

 

sudo apt-get install -y build-essential

をターミナルから実行するだけ!

 

これで最低限の開発/ビルド環境が整いました。

残りはMakefileを使ってmakeするなり、素でgcc叩くなりお好きにどうぞ。

 

ちなみにインストールされるパッケージの情報は以下を参考にしてください。

Ubuntu – bionic の build-essential パッケージに関する詳細

Debian — sid の build-essential パッケージに関する詳細

以上です。

 

追記 2019-03-06 : なんかbuild-essentialじゃなくてbuild-essentialsとか意味不明なパッケージになっていたので修正